Basic Information
| Product Name | 6-Hydroxycrinamine |
| CAS No. | 545-66-4 |
| Molecular Formula | C16H17NO4 |
| Molecular Weight | 287.31 g/mol |
| Synonyms | 6-Hydroxycrinamine; Crinamine, 6-hydroxy-; 3,4-Didehydro-8,9-methylenedioxy-5-methyl-5,10b-ethanophenanthridine-2,6-diol; 6-Hydroxy-crinamine; (5α,10bβ)-3,4-Didehydro-8,9-(methylenedioxy)-5-methyl-5,10b-ethanophenanthridine-2,6-diol |
